What is Legacy Direct Insurance for Small Businesses?

Legacy Insurance for small businesses follows the same principle as direct insurance for individuals but is tailored to meet the needs of small business owners. It involves purchasing insurance policies directly from the insurer without the involvement of intermediaries such as agents or brokers. This direct interaction allows businesses to obtain coverage more efficiently and often at lower costs.

Considerations for Small Businesses

While Legacy Direct Insurance offers numerous benefits, small businesses should consider the following factors before opting for this insurance model:

  1. Risk Assessment: Small businesses must accurately assess their insurance needs and ensure that the coverage provided meets their specific requirements.

  2. Policy Limits and Exclusions: It's essential to carefully review policy terms, coverage limits, and exclusions to avoid potential gaps in coverage that could leave the business vulnerable to unforeseen risks.

  3. Claims Handling Process: Understanding the claims handling process is crucial for small businesses, as efficient claims resolution is essential during times of crisis or loss.

  4. Comparison Shopping: Small businesses should compare quotes from multiple direct insurance providers to ensure they're getting the best coverage at the most competitive price.
